目录
- 什么是 fhs-install-v2ray?
- 为什么要使用 fhs-install-v2ray?
- 如何安装 fhs-install-v2ray?
- 如何配置 fhs-install-v2ray?
- 常见问题解答
什么是 fhs-install-v2ray?
fhs-install-v2ray 是一个用于在 Linux 系统上安装和配置 V2Ray 的脚本。它遵循 Filesystem Hierarchy Standard (FHS) 标准,将 V2Ray 的所有文件和配置分布在不同的目录中,使系统管理更加规范和清晰。
为什么要使用 fhs-install-v2ray?
使用 fhs-install-v2ray 脚本安装和配置 V2Ray 有以下几个优点:
- 遵循 FHS 标准: 文件和配置按照 FHS 标准存放在不同的目录中,使系统管理更加规范。
- 自动化安装: 脚本会自动下载最新版本的 V2Ray 并进行安装,大大简化了安装过程。
- 自动化配置: 脚本会自动生成基本的配置文件,用户只需要根据需求进行少量修改即可。
- 自动化更新: 脚本会自动检查 V2Ray 的版本,并提供一键更新的功能。
如何安装 fhs-install-v2ray?
要安装 fhs-install-v2ray,请按照以下步骤操作:
-
打开终端并切换到 root 用户: bash sudo -i
-
下载并运行安装脚本: bash curl -O https://raw.githubusercontent.com/v2ray/fhs-install-v2ray/master/install-release.sh && bash install-release.sh
-
脚本会自动下载最新版本的 V2Ray 并进行安装。安装完成后,您可以在
/etc/v2ray/config.json
中查看默认配置文件。
如何配置 fhs-install-v2ray?
要配置 fhs-install-v2ray,请按照以下步骤操作:
-
打开默认的配置文件: bash vi /etc/v2ray/config.json
-
根据您的需求修改配置文件。您可以参考 V2Ray 的官方文档来了解各个配置项的含义。
-
保存并退出配置文件后,重启 V2Ray 服务: bash systemctl restart v2ray
-
您可以使用
systemctl status v2ray
命令检查 V2Ray 服务的状态。
常见问题解答
1. 如何更新 fhs-install-v2ray?
要更新 fhs-install-v2ray,请运行以下命令: bash bash install-release.sh –update
脚本会自动检查 V2Ray 的最新版本并进行更新。
2. 如何卸载 fhs-install-v2ray?
要卸载 fhs-install-v2ray,请运行以下命令: bash bash install-release.sh –remove
脚本会自动卸载 V2Ray 并删除相关文件。
3. 如何手动配置 V2Ray?
如果您需要更复杂的配置,可以手动编辑 /etc/v2ray/config.json
文件。您可以参考 V2Ray 的官方文档来了解各个配置项的含义。
4. 如何查看 V2Ray 的日志?
V2Ray 的日志文件位于 /var/log/v2ray/
目录下。您可以使用以下命令查看日志: bash tail -n 100 /var/log/v2ray/access.log tail -n 100 /var/log/v2ray/error.log
5. 如何启用 V2Ray 的 WebSocket 模式?
要启用 WebSocket 模式,您需要在 /etc/v2ray/config.json
文件中进行如下修改:
- 在
inbound
部分添加 WebSocket 配置:
“inbounds”: [ { “port”: 8080, “protocol”: “vmess”, “settings”: { “clients”: [ { “id”: “your-uuid-here”, “alterId”: 64 } ] }, “streamSettings”: { “network”: “ws”, “wsSettings”: { “path”: “/your-path-here” } } } ]
- 在
outbound
部分添加 WebSocket 配置:
“out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“your-server-address”, “port”: 443, “users”: [ { “id”: “your-uuid-here”, “alterId”: 64 } ] } ] }, “streamSettings”: { “network”: “ws”, “wsSettings”: { “path”: “/your-path-here” } } } ]
- 将
your-uuid-here
和your-path-here
替换为您自己的值,然后重启 V2Ray 服务。
更多配置细节可以参考 V2Ray 的官方文档。
如果您还有其他问题,欢迎在评论区留言。我们会尽快为您解答。